We had the most delightful stay at the Rockhaven B&B's tiny, retro Camp Hike-n-Bike cabin, hosted by Lynn and Christian. The accomodations and location in Harper's Ferry are superb! Lynn and Christian have meticulously thought out every detail of this cabin to ensure your stay is pleasant, care-free, and relaxing.We were welcomed with two cans of pear prosecco, and blueberry muffins! The kitchenette is beyond adequate for a solo traveler or couple! There were plenty of utensils, dinnerware, glasses, and coffee mugs- the French press was an absolute delight! In addition the cabin comes equipped with bath towels, toiletries, lotion, sunscreen, aloe (definitely a plus after a long day tubing on the Shenandoah), bug spray, first aid kit, additional pillows, and more! Again, I can not stress enough how much thought has gone into every little detail of this tiny cabin! You must walk through their beautiful garden, which is truly a labor of love!We enjoyed mornings and evenings on the screened porch, illuminated by vintage string lights. The porch fan provides a comfortable setting even in the August heat! We were fortunate enough to have an evening storm which we enjoyed from the screened porch listening to the pitter patter of the rain on the tin roof! Side note, Bolivar Bread Bakery, less than a minutes drive and only about 5 minute walk, is a must! Their pastries and baked goods are delicious! In addition, Harper's Ferry lower town is just a moments drive and is a must see! Be cautious of parking as that can be rather tricky but there are ways around it!We could not have been more pleased with our visit!
